Subject: Handover — date localization release duties

Hey — quick brain dump before I'm out. The Daymarsh localization release goes out biweekly; the tricky bit is regenerating the locale date-format tables before tagging, or week-numbering breaks in a few regions. Checklist is on the wiki. Builds must be signed before publish, same as always. The current signing key is below.

signing key of bagap-yawep = bky13_TbfT6ZMUoGJo2

Ticket: Missed pick-up — replacement safe lock

Hi records team, small headache: the courier was supposed to collect the replacement lock mechanism for the archive safe from Tarnwell Security Supply yesterday afternoon, but the run got bumped and nobody told us. The old lock is already pulled, so the safe is currently on the temporary bolt — not great. I've rebooked collection for first thing tomorrow with Quickhaven Couriers. When the driver arrives at our dock, the hand-over must follow the confidential instruction below.

dispatch memo: the eliok quenok courier leaves the sorael aldath belion tammir casix gileth queniel jorath ledger at gate 9299 under passcode 897989

Handover note — EXIF scrubbing service (PixRinse), from Tomas to Ade. The scrubber strips GPS, serial, and maker-note tags on upload before anything hits the CDN. It runs as a sidecar to the media gateway; failures reject the upload rather than passing it through unscrubbed. Tag allowlists live in the repo, not the database. New folks: the service reads its runtime configuration as shown below.

config for kajef-hahof:
[ulamir]
port = 5672
region = central-1
host = ulamir.lumicsys.corp
timeout_ms = 2000
retries = 3

Onboarding notes — Eventline Schema Registry (for weekly eng sync). New services at Brindlecote must register every event schema with the Eventline registry before publishing to any topic. The registry enforces backward compatibility on all revisions, so coordinate with Priya on the platform team before bumping a major version. Local development runs against the staging registry, which requires authenticated writes for all schema uploads. Add the following line to your .env so the registry client can authenticate on startup.

sealed setting: ARCHIVE_KEY3=8d0